NOTE TO LECTURE ON "PAUL"<br />

In quot<strong>in</strong>g evidence of the double doctr<strong>in</strong>e ascribed to Paul, I omitted one of the most<br />

conclusive illustrations of the fact. We read <strong>in</strong> Galatians iii. 13--"Christ hath redeemed us<br />

from the Curse of the Law, be<strong>in</strong>g made a Curse for us: for it is written, Cursed is every<br />

one that hangeth on a Tree." The object of hang<strong>in</strong>g the Condemned One on the tree was<br />

to make him Accursed. But what says the voice of Paul the Gnostic <strong>in</strong> another text (Cor.<br />

xii. 3)?--"No man speak<strong>in</strong>g by the Spirit of God calleth Jesus Accursed, and no man can<br />

say that Jesus is the Lord but by the Holy Spirit." That is, the Christ of the Gnosis could<br />

not become accursed, could not be hung upon a tree, and no Gnostic would say that Jesus<br />

was the KURIOS save <strong>in</strong> the mystical or esoteric sense. Here the Historic and Gnostic<br />

doctr<strong>in</strong>es are directly antipodal. This aga<strong>in</strong> is the teach<strong>in</strong>g of Paul--"Say not <strong>in</strong> thy heart,<br />

Who shall ascend <strong>in</strong>to Heaven? (that is, to br<strong>in</strong>g Christ down;) or, Who shall descend<br />

<strong>in</strong>to the abyss? (that is, to br<strong>in</strong>g Christ up from the Dead.) The Word is nigh thee, <strong>in</strong> thy<br />

mouth, and <strong>in</strong> thy heart." That is, the Word as preached by Paul. Then follows the<br />

<strong>in</strong>terpolation. Also, as an illustration of the statement made by Clement Alexander--that<br />

Paul said he would br<strong>in</strong>g the Gnosis or Hidden Wisdom to the Brethren <strong>in</strong> Rome--it<br />

should have been shown by me that the teach<strong>in</strong>g of the Epistle (ch. i. 23-32) is taken<br />

almost bodily and repeated nearly verbatim from ch. xiv. 12-31 of the "Wisdom of<br />

Solomon."<br />
